Stars and Planets: An Astral Adventure

One of the most popular playroom ceiling ideas is to create a celestial wonderland. After all, who wouldn't want to sleep under the stars every night?

This theme is perfect for adding a touch of magic to your child's room. It encourages them to look up and dream about the vast universe, sparking their curiosity and love for learning.

Create a mesmerizing glow-in-the-dark galaxy with galaxy globes, adhesive stars, and a DIY constellation projector. These elements will make your child's ceiling twinkle like the night sky, creating a perfect bedtime ambiance.

For an extra touch, paint the ceiling with glow-in-the-dark paint, making it look like a real night sky. When the lights go out, the ceiling will seem like a canvas of endless stars and galaxies.

Suspend a mobile of planets and moons from the ceiling, giving your child's room a gravity-defying effect. This interactive display encourages them to explore the universe while learning about planetary sizes and distances.

You can also make your own mobiles using foam balls, beeswax, and a bit of creativity. Plus, it's an excellent crafting activity to do with your kids!

Bring storybook characters and fairy tales to life by painting a mural on the ceiling. This playroom ceiling idea fosters a sense of creativity and wonder, making bedtime stories even more enchanting.

With a ceiling mural, you can create a tangible connection between the stories you read and the world around your child, encouraging them to engage with tales in a whole new way.

Under the Sea: A Mermaid's Room

Paint a captivating underwater scene on the ceiling, complete with swimming fish, playful dolphins, and a magnificent sunken treasure. Add some sparkly fish scales made from shiny fabric or aluminum foil to make it irresistible for your little one.

To enhance the mermaid theme, consider adding some sea-inspired lighting, like swirling blue and purple LED lights that mimic the glow of the ocean depths.

Jungle Jamboree: A Safari Adventure

Bring the excitement of the safari to your child's playroom with a vivid jungle ceiling mural. Depict a lush, green canopy teeming with wildlife, such as giraffes, elephants, and friendly monkeys.

For extra fun, include some animals peeking out from behind the walls or playing on the furniture. This theme encourages your child to interact with the mural, letting their imagination run wild.
